Default Big Gator Pike 9/6/15

I wasn't planning on fishing the river this weekend, but the offshore tuna trip was cancelled and I had little bit of time so I gave it a shot. I had fish almost immediately, but the hooks pulled on the first two fish. I continued down the river and caught and released a 20-22" pickerel. After I released the fish, I had a look at my leader and it had a little nick in it, but I was being lazy and just kept fishing.

I continued to fish slightly downstream from where I usually stop, and had a quick blowup but the fish quickly lost interest. I took one more cast, and my lure got slammed by the one I was looking for.

I saw the fish hit the lure, and then it powered toward the nearest snag. All I could think about was the fact that I hadn't changed my nicked leader (won't do that again). Thankfully, everything held and after a short, tough fight I had the fish at my feet. The pike taped out between 36 and 37". After the release, I fished a little while longer and released another 30" fish before I called it a day.
